When he had started dating Kon, Tim gave Dick one piece of advice. Do not let Kon talking you into anything. Dick just snorted and waved off his little brother's concern. Dick was a Bat, and he was not that easily swayed into doing something he didn't want to do.
Unfortunately, that wasn't what Tim had meant. Dick found this out the hard way. Now, he had a bit of a crisis on his hand, and Kon was of no help. Kon was more panicked than Dick was. “Batman's gonna kill us,” Kon bemoaned as he crawled out of the batmobile, his clothes messily put back on. “Dude, why didn't you talk me out of this?”
Dick followed Kon out of the batmobile, cringing a little when he glanced back at the mess they had made of the upholstery. “I think the answer to that is I was a bit distracted,” Dick answered. “Someone's tactile telekinesis had somehow sneaked into my pants.”
Kon at least had the decency to flush at that. “Well, it's not my fault your ass is awesome and was begging to be groped!” he announced, still worried about the car. “But seriously, we're so dead.”
Dick was about to agree when he noticed a post it on the hood of the car. He walked over and pick it up to read. He snorted before handing it to Kon who flushed a bit more. “Crisis averted,” Dick announced cheerfully. “Though, you have to wonder how Tim knows how to get these kind of stains out of the upholstery.”
“I'm more wondering how he knew we were gonna have sex in the batmobile,” he grumbled as Dick laughed.
Dick threw an arm around Kon's shoulders. “That's not what matters right now. Right now, we clean up our mess. C'mon, the supplies should be in 'cave somewhere.”
Kon sighed and nodded, following Dick's lead. Best they clean up their mess now. An angry Batman was not a Super's friend.
